Best Schools in Emerson, IA
Emerson, IA has a total of 8 schools including 3 high schools, 2 middle schools and 3 elementary schools. A total of 2,421 students attend Emerson, IA schools. On average, schools in Emerson score 61%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 52%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Emerson greatly exceed exp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Emerson, IA
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Emerson, IA has a total population of 635 with 24%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 88%, and 14%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
